The licenses are compatible (as far as I can see), but require that the original authors receive proper attribution. So the articles have to be ported over with their history intact or (going by the license agreement on EvoWiki) there needs to be a reference to the original EvoWiki article alongside the copied content. 141.134.75.236 (talk) 21:18, 4 July 2015 (UTC)

For ease of reading, the letters converted to long form:
  1. There is a perfect being Stricly implies It is logically necessary thatThere is a perfect being (Amselm's primciple)
    This is essentially valid. If it weren't, then things could be true without warrant. (That said, it's possible that our logic is insufficient, and the being exists for some extralogical reason(s).)
  2. It is logically necessary thatThere is a perfect being Or It is not the case thatIt is logically necessary thatThere is a perfect being (excluded middle)
    This is valid. Either something is true or false.
  3. It is not the case thatIt is logically necessary thatThere is a perfect being Stricly implies It is logically necessary that It is not the case thatIt is logically necessary thatThere is a perfect being (Becker's postulate)
    Becker's postulateWikipedia: "the claim that modal status is necessary (for instance that the possibility of P implies the necessity of the possibility of P, and also the iteration of necessity)". This is valid, for the same reason as 1.
  4. It is logically necessary thatThere is a perfect being Or It is logically necessary that It is not the case thatIt is logically necessary thatThere is a perfect being (from 2 and 3)
    This follows; they just remove ~Nq (the middle term) from the Nq v ~Nq and ~Nq -> N~Nq statements.
  5. It is logically necessary that It is not the case thatIt is logically necessary thatThere is a perfect being Stricly implies It is logically necessary that It is not the case thatThere is a perfect being (from 1)
    This essentially says that, if you disproved a perfect being, there isn't a perfect being. This is justified on the same grounds as 1.
  6. It is logically necessary thatThere is a perfect being Or It is logically necessary that It is not the case thatThere is a perfect being (from 4 and 5)
    Again, removal of the middle term. Nq v N~Nq and N~Nq -> N~q makes Nq v N~q. Essentially, premises 1-6 have merely proven that either there is or isn't a perfect being, depending on logical necessity.
  7. It is not the case thatIt is logically necessary that It is not the case thatThere is a perfect being (imtuitive postulate)
    7 asserts that it is possible for a perfect being to exist. This premise is immensely flawed. (See omnipotence paradox, problem of evil, and so many other issues.) However, it's entirely valid.
  8. It is logically necessary thatThere is a perfect being (from 6 and 7)
    When given two choices, one of which is impossible, you must choose the possible. Valid.
  9. It is logically necessary thatThere is a perfect being Stricly implies There is a perfect being (modal axiom)
    9 is reverse 1. Pretty valid.
  10. There is a perfect being (from 8 and 9)
    Valid.
Fact is, the ontological argument is logically valid in current logics. Its issues come with premises 1 and 7 and q. 1, as noted, is reliant on logic being an accurate descriptor of truth; this appears a pretty decent assumption, but given that logic has changed (and that logic, unlike science, asserts absolute rather than provisional truth) this may be incorrect. 7 relies on the possibility of the existence of a perfect being, which is actually a very very weak assertion -- when was the last time science detected a "perfect" being, and how can we know any can possibly exist? q can be substituted for anything -- replace it with "the most perfect chocolate chip sundae" or "the most evil darkdoer Satan" and it's still valid.
